Shot on 8mm film in 1964, this vintage home movie captures a bustling train station in Evanston, Illinois. The sequence begins with a view of a large building featuring a prominent radar dome and a covered platform. A bright yellow train engine, likely from the Chicago and North Western Railway, approaches and stops at the station. Passengers, dressed in period-appropriate 1960s attire, walk along the platform with luggage, boarding or disembarking. The footage exhibits classic Super 8 grain, color shifts, and a handheld perspective, offering a nostalgic glimpse into mid-century American transportation and daily life.
